Common Materials for Machinery & Equipment Parts

For machinery and equipment parts, material selection is often linked to load, wear, corrosion, shaft fit, surface treatment, and assembly conditions. If the drawing is not fully clear, OUJI can help review the material and process risk before quotation.

Material Category Common Options Typical Machinery Use
Aluminum 6061, 6063, 6082, 7075 and similar grades Lightweight machine plates, brackets, covers, fixtures, housings, mounting parts, and equipment components
Stainless Steel 304, 316, 303 and similar grades Corrosion-resistant machinery parts, shafts, brackets, covers, food-related equipment parts, and durable fixtures
Carbon Steel Q235, 45#, 1045, A36 and similar grades Machine bases, mounting plates, structural parts, fixture bases, brackets, and equipment supports
Alloy / Tool Steel 4140, 40Cr, SKD11, D2, H13 and similar materials Wear parts, tooling components, shafts, high-strength supports, hardened parts, and mechanical functional parts
Engineering Plastics POM, PA, PEEK, PTFE, ABS, PC and similar plastics Sliding parts, insulating parts, protective covers, lightweight supports, low-friction components, and machine accessories
Surface Finishes Anodizing, plating, passivation, black oxide, powder coating, blasting, polishing Corrosion resistance, wear support, appearance, protection, identification, and assembly requirements
Manufacturing note: For machinery and equipment parts, drawings should clearly mark critical dimensions, mating surfaces, fit areas, thread requirements, tolerance notes, heat treatment, surface finish, and any functional contact surfaces.

Inspection Priorities for Machinery Parts

Machinery parts often affect equipment assembly, machine stability, movement, installation accuracy, and long-term use. Even simple-looking components may require careful control of hole positions, flatness, perpendicularity, thread quality, surface treatment, and burr removal.

Hole position, mounting features, datum surfaces, and assembly-related dimensions

Flatness, parallelism, perpendicularity, shaft fit, and contact surface review

Thread quality, counterbores, pockets, bearing seats, and functional machining details

Burr control, edge treatment, heat treatment, surface finish, coating, and packaging protection
